Khukh Nuur, translating to "Blue Lake" in Mongolian, is a natural freshwater lake situated in the Hentiy province of Mongolia. The lake is renowned for its clear blue waters and peaceful environment, making it a favored spot for nature lovers and travelers seeking tranquility away from urban centers. It is surrounded by typical Mongolian steppe landscapes, offering scenic views and opportunities for bird watching and fishing. The area around Khukh Nuur is relatively untouched, preserving its natural beauty and biodiversity. Visitors can experience traditional nomadic culture in nearby settlements, adding cultural significance to the natural allure of the lake. While not a major tourist hub, Khukh Nuur provides an authentic experience of Mongolia's vast and unspoiled wilderness. Its remote location means that infrastructure is minimal, appealing primarily to adventurous travelers and those interested in eco-tourism. The lake's ecosystem supports various aquatic species and migratory birds, contributing to its ecological importance within the region.

Tip: The best time to visit Khukh Nuur is during the summer months when the weather is mild and the lake is accessible. Due to its remote location, visitors should prepare adequately with supplies and transportation. Booking local guides can enhance the experience by providing insights into the natural environment and nearby nomadic culture. There are no formal entrance fees, but respecting the natural habitat and local customs is essential. Visitors are advised to check weather conditions beforehand, as access may be limited during harsh winters.
